  12. I get it now. According to BillyCrusher's post, the real F-5 manual says that the left missile will always give a tone even if not selected, but the right one won't. This could be understood that way and maybe BST deduced from that that it actually has to be this way. From my experience these manuals can be confusing in the shortened language that they use and if not read in the right context. And I experienced this matter different when doing maintenance checks on the missile tone, I only heared the tone after switching either the left or the right or both of the stations 1 and 7 up. So in my opinion the tone should not be audible only after putting GUNS/MISSILE and CAMERA on, but after the station is selected.

  17. Upfront: Absolutely outstanding module, BST! Love it to it's smallest details, way worth the wait! So, since there's no real bug sub-section I thought I'd list whatever I find in bugs here. Some may have been reported already, I tried to read everything so forgive me if I have something doubled up. (I was mech and maintenance on the Tiger F-5E in switzerland, thats where I get my sources of how it should be from. If i complain about something that is different in the moddeled version (there are so many and they are so similar) then just disregard it.) - Rockets - Bomb Selector to Ripple = crash to windows: When have rockets loaded and selected and I put the bomb selector knob to 'ripple' and press bomb release, the game crashes to desktop. Happened twice, should be repeatable. - Gear movement after being destroyed: When I watched my plane being shot down from F2 view, the gear was going in and out and in again on the falling wreck. There shouldn't be any hydraulics left for that :smilewink: - Aim9 seeker head sound always audible even if station 1 and 7 are not selected. AFAIK only when the stations are selected and weapons armed it should be audible. (As experienced on weapon function control routine) (^^ According to BillyCrushers find in the manual, this is not true. In my experience, after master arm on, no sound is audible untill station with Aim-9 is selected.) - Aim-9 seeker uncage doesn't match up: If the assigned joystick button is pressed, the uncage button in the cockpit on the throttle doesn't move, instead when 'pipper arrest' or whatever it is called in english (Lshift + C command) is pressed the uncage button moves in the cockpit. Function of pressing the uncage on HOTAS is still correct though. - Pipper in HUD doesn't follow locked target when uncaged. This should be the case. (As experienced on weapon function control routine) (^^ Explanation: When a target is aquired and the uncage is pressed, the Pipper including the Circle around it is uncaged as well, moving with the target. We tested this by shining a torch into the seeker head and in the cockpit we could see the pipper move in the direction that the torch was moved.) - Gunsmoke deflectors should close 10 seconds after the trigger is released, not immediately.
